New Series Beginning

By Jeff Adolph

LGBT Residential Real Estate

Last week concluded our 'Around the Nation' series, where I progressively went through each states real estate facts and figures and gave you a sounder understanding of the real estate climate in each, as well as where LGBT communities were gravitating to.

This week I am beginning a new series that possibly will have no ending, as I am focusing on those gayest zip-codes that we uncovered in our last series. This series will be entitled 'LGBT Zipcodes -- A Closer Look', and shall uncover what is 'new' in a residential sense, in each of the locations that we discovered. So hold on to your realty because this new series is going to the backbone of Gay RealEstate USA, and it will enable you to know what makes the gayest locations in America so great, as well as why the LGBT community gravitate to each in a realty and lifestyle sense.
